Beautiful hiking trail that can also be extended towards Rettenbachalm. Further hiking through the extensive alpine pasture area to the Rettenbachklamm and Blaa-Alm is possible. The Rettenbach Alm offers the best regional cuisine and snacks from surrounding farms.
